New Water Well (Bore Hole) at Jehovah Jireh Church
Warmest greetings from us to you and the rest of the Amigos family and the 4AFRICA team.Firstly, am glad report to you the that the water well (Bore Hole) at Jehovah Jireh Church – Kabedopong, Gulu is already fully mounted and the church, school and surrounding community members in the area have already starting accessing the water from this clean source. Secondly, the water well shall be attached to the Resource and Practical Development Department of the Church, and a WATER RESOURCE COMMITTEE was formed after Thanksgiving prayers yesterday, Sunday, 14.10.18, to help in effective and efficient management of the water and ensure sustainability of the project; Rev. Capt. Okere Jackson, the General Overseer Jehovah Jireh Church will be their PATRON. Access to clean water is a fundamental human right and an essential step towards improving living standards worldwide (Gulu), and since an average person on earth requires at least 20 to 50 Litres of clean, safe water a day for drinking, cooking or simply keeping themselves clean, the impact of this completed phase of the project is immense already!!! I believe the project will reduce on the number of death due to diarrheal diseases such as typhoid, cholera, dysentery, among other host water sickness.Â
Education will also not suffer anymore due to sick children missing schools because the community is now “water – rich” and economic opportunities will also not be routinely lost because there will be isolated cases of people rampantly become ill. Additionally, availability of this water well will also have wider implications through its contributions in other aspect of life. The water well’s ready availability at the site will save time spent by especially women and children (girls) that bears the brunt burden of collecting water each day from long distances.

We received a great update from Patrick in Gulu, Uganda, on the water well that we are installing for their community. This area has been affected by disease due to lack of clean water, so this is a great project for us!
From Patrick:
“Warmest greetings to you all. I am glad to report to you progress on the Aqua4Life project at Jehovah Jireh Church. The water well drilling was completed at 50 meters and mobilization of mainly construction materials was done in the past days, and construction/mounting was completed earlier today. The screed/smoothing done will be left for 2 to 3 days to cure before finally doing PUMP TESTING!! Thanks for the the generosity and support… Thanks for the patience.
